Exploring Oslo's Viking Ship Museum
Journey back time at the renowned Viking Ship Museum in Oslo, Norway. Nestled on the banks of the serene Bygdøy peninsula, this museum showcases three remarkably ancient Viking ships: the Oseberg ship, the Gokstad ship, and the Tune ship. These grand vessels, built from the 9th to an 10th century, offer a intriguing glimpse into the sophisticated shipbuilding techniques and cultural customs of the Viking era.
The museum's detailed collection also includes a wealth of artifacts, such as weapons, tools, furniture, and personal belongings, in addition sheding light on the daily lives of Vikings.
